In this paper, we study the problem of differential pricing and QoS
assignment by a broadband data provider. In our model, the broadband data
provider decides on the power allocated to an end-user not only based on
parameters of the transmission medium, but also based on the price the user is
willing to pay. In addition, end-users bid the price that they are willing to
pay to the BTS based on their channel condition, the throughput they require,
and their belief about other users' parameters. We will characterize the
optimum power allocation by the BTS which turns out to be a modification of the
solution to the well-known water-filling problem. We also characterize the
optimum bidding strategy of end-users using the belief of each user about the
